Job Purpose
The role of the Hygiene Operative is to ensure the environment is safe and clean to prevent a negative impact on quality standards.
Key Responsibilities
- Implement all Health and Safety policies and procedures ensuring compliance with legislation and aligned to best practice.
- Clean all pre-established mill floors, walls and machinery on a rotational basis or as required. This will require working in confined spaces and working at height. Enable KPI's for hygiene to be met to prevent a negative impact on quality standards.
- Clean all spillages and trailers in the mill yard as and when required. Ensure the environment is safe and clean, mitigating risks to health and safety.
- Proactively respond to any incidents or environmental concerns which could negatively impact health and safety and quality standards. Promptly notify the Mill Management team of any concerns which are considered to merit immediate attention.
- Responsibility to ensure that feed is made and handled in a way that all Food safety standards and requirements are adhered to, maintaining standards of good practice to minimise any food safety risk to both the birds consuming the feed and the end consumer.
- Completion of daily paperwork, proactively seeking solutions where abnormalities occur to prevent a negative impact on production and quality standards.
- Liaise with other operational areas to ensure the efficient flow of information so all internal and external customer requirements are met.
- Drive continuous improvement, proactively reviewing current methodology and opportunities to improve the sites efficiency, safety, quality and performance.
- Manage and maintain all sites waste to the correct environment agency standards.
- Undertake any reasonable task as required and as directed by the mill management team.
